Red flags
62% of nursing staff left within a year
High turnover disrupts continuity of care; the national median is 45%.

CMS ratings & staffing
Overall: 3 of 5 Inspections: 3 of 5 Staffing: 4 of 5 Quality measures: 4 of 5
| Total nurse hours / resident-day | 4.43 | 3.48 min · 4.1 strong |
|---|---|---|
| RN hours / resident-day | 1.50 | 0.55–0.75 |
| Weekend hours / resident-day | 3.51 | ≈ weekday level |
| Nursing turnover / year | 62% | median 45% |
| Fines (3-yr window) | none |
